Manchester United boss manager Jose Mourinho will reportedly demand Neymar if Paris Saint-Germain try to sign Paul Pogba and Anthony Martial.

Manchester United boss Jose Mourinho has reportedly decided to ask for Neymar should Paris Saint-Germain move for Paul Pogba and Anthony Martial.

The French duo have been linked with an end-of-season switch to PSG as Ligue 1's richest club seeks to strengthen its ranks ahead of a 2018-19 Champions League tilt.

According to the Daily Star, the Man United manager is willing to test the Parisians' resolve by asking for the world's most expensive player as part of the deal.

The report suggests that the Red Devils would be seeking to trade in Pogba and Martial, plus £50m, in exchange for Neymar, who continues to be linked with a departure from the Parc des Princes.

The Brazil international has scored 29 goals and registered 19 assists in 30 PSG appearances this season but is currently out with a foot injury.
